.fs-container--item-list {
  width: 80%;
  -webkit-transform: translate(0%, 0%);
  transform: translate(0%, 0%);
}

.fs-container--skill-list {
  width: 30%;
  -webkit-transform: translate(0%, 0%);
  transform: translate(0%, 0%);
}

.fs-container--description {
  padding-top: 4%;
  padding-bottom: 1%;
  padding-left: 5%;
  padding-right: 5%;
}

.fs-container--item-list--build {
  position: relative;
  padding-bottom: 104% !important;
  background: url("https://albiononline.pl/wp-content/uploads/build-place-holer.png");
  background-size: cover;
}

.fs-container--skill-list--build {
  position: relative;
  padding-bottom: 350% !important;
  background: url("https://albiononline.pl/wp-content/uploads/skills-placeholder.png");
  background-size: cover;
}

.fs-item-list {
  /* overflow: hidden; */
  padding: 6px 0 12px;
  text-align: center;
}

.fs-skill-list {
  /* overflow: hidden; */
  padding: 6px 0 12px;
  text-align: center;
}

.fs-item {
  position: absolute;
  display: inline-block;
  width: 24%; /* Adjust as needed */
  height: 24%; /* Adjust as needed */
  line-height: 1; /* Adjust as needed */
  margin: -1% 0; /* Adjust as needed */
  /* overflow: hidden; */
  text-overflow: ellipsis;
}

.fs-tooltip-item {
  visibility: hidden;
  width: 200%;
  background-color: #555;
  color: #fff;
  /* text-align: center; */
  padding: 5px 0;
  border-radius: 6px;
  position: absolute;
  z-index: 1;
  /* bottom: -30%; */
  /* right: 30%; */
  transform: translate(-50%, -50%);
  opacity: 0;
  transition: opacity 0.3s;
}

.fs-item:hover .fs-tooltip-item {
  visibility: visible;
  opacity: 1;
}

.fs-tooltip-skill {
  visibility: hidden;
  width: 500%;
  background-color: #555;
  color: #fff;
  /* text-align: center; */
  padding: 5px 0;
  border-radius: 6px;
  position: absolute;
  z-index: 1;
  /* bottom: -30%; */
  /* right: 30%; */
  transform: translate(-50%, -50%);
  opacity: 0;
  transition: opacity 0.3s;
}

.fs-skill:hover .fs-tooltip-skill {
  visibility: visible;
  opacity: 1;
}

.fs-item--head {
  top: 10%;
  left: 38%;
}

.fs-item--chest {
  top: 32%;
  left: 38%;
}

.fs-item--boots {
  top: 54.5%;
  left: 38%;
}

.fs-item--mainhand {
  top: 32%;
  left: 11.5%;
}

.fs-item--secondhand {
  top: 32%;
  left: auto;
  right: 11%;
}

.fs-item--bag {
  top: 7.5%;
  left: 6%;
}

.fs-item--cape {
  top: 7.5%;
  left: auto;
  right: 6%;
}

.fs-item--food {
  top: 57.5%;
  left: 6%;
}

.fs-item--potion {
  top: 57.5%;
  left: auto;
  right: 6%;
}

.fs-item--mount {
  top: 76.5%;
  left: 38%;
}

.fs-skill {
  position: absolute;
  display: inline-block;
  width: 35%; /* Adjust as needed */
  /* height: 35%; Adjust as needed */
  line-height: 1; /* Adjust as needed */
  margin: -1% 0; /* Adjust as needed */
  /* overflow: hidden; */
  text-overflow: ellipsis;
}

.fs-skill--weapon-active-skill-1 {
  top: 17.3%;
  left: 6.5%;
}

.fs-skill--weapon-active-skill-2 {
  top: 29.3%;
  left: 6.5%;
}

.fs-skill--weapon-active-skill-3 {
  top: 41.3%;
  left: 6.5%;
}

.fs-skill--weapon-passive-skill-1 {
  top: 53%;
  left: 7%;
}

.fs-skill--head-active-skill-1 {
  top: 12%;
  right: 13%;
}

.fs-skill--head-passive-skill-1 {
  top: 23.9%;
  right: 13%;
}

.fs-skill--chest-active-skill-1 {
  top: 35.8%;
  right: 13%;
}

.fs-skill--chest-passive-skill-1 {
  top: 47.6%;
  right: 13%;
}

.fs-skill--chest-passive-skill-2 {
  top: 59.6%;
  right: 13%;
}

.fs-skill--boots-active-skill-1 {
  top: 71.4%;
  right: 13.5%;
}

.fs-skill--boots-passive-skill-1 {
  top: 83.2%;
  right: 13%;
}

.fs-spinner {
  position: absolute;
  top: 25%;
  left: 35%;
  border: 16px solid var(--fs-background-2-color);
  border-top: 16px solid var(--fs-header-color);
  border-radius: 50%;
  width: 120px;
  height: 120px;
  animation: spin 0.75s linear infinite;
}

.fs-skill--label--dmg {
  font-weight: bold;
  color: #ff2e2e;
}

.fs-skill--label--other {
  font-weight: bold;
  color: #edd5c7;
}

.fs-skill--label--cc {
  font-weight: bold;
  color: #ffb418;
}

.fs-skill--label--debuff {
  font-weight: bold;
  color: #c27af0;
}

.fs-skill--label--buff {
  font-weight: bold;
  color: #20c7ff;
}

.fs-skill--label--mobility {
  font-weight: bold;
  color: #ffffff;
}

.fs-skill--label--heal {
  font-weight: bold;
  color: #6acc04;
}

@keyframes spin {
  0% {
    transform: rotate(0deg);
  }
  100% {
    transform: rotate(360deg);
  }
}
